牛黄体中促黄体素受体剪接异构体的表达研究
Expression of Luteinizing hormone receptor splice variants in bovine corpus luteum

【摘要】 利用RT-PCR结合测序技术,对牛黄体中促黄体素受体(Luteinizing hormone receptor,LHR)在转录后通过选择性剪接而形成的剪接异构体进行鉴定,并比较不同剪接异构体编码蛋白质氨基酸序列的差异,利用Real-Time PCR对黄体中的LHR剪接异构体进行定量分析,为研究LHR剪接异构体在黄体中的功能奠定基础。结果表明,牛黄体中LHR通过选择性剪接产生了包括全长mRNA在内的6种剪接异构体,其中第11外显子5’端的266个碱基的缺失会使mRNA因发生移码突变而使翻译提前终止。实时定量PCR结果显示,发生外显子缺失的mRNA的表达量总量是全长mRNA表达量的1.94倍。
【Abstract】 In this paper,RT-PCR and sequencing technique was employed to identify the splice variants of Luteinzing hormone receptor(LHR) in bovine corpus luteum.The difference of deduced protein sequence of the variants was compared.And the expression level of these splice variants was quantified by Real-Time PCR.The results indicated that six isoforms of LHR were identified, and variants lacking the first 266 of exon 11 generated a frame shift,and produced a premature codon,.The result of Real-Time PCR showed that total expression of B,C,D,E and F was 1.94 fold compared with A..
